Themost common signs of bad ignition coils in Alfa Romeo Stelvio are engine hesitation when accelerating or loss of power, rough idle, misfires, excessive fuel consumption, check engine light illuminates, and sometimes hard starting. In worst case scenario, if the ignition coils are in really bad condition, the engine will not start.

Whenmy battery died the dealer exchanged it for free but not before testing like they did with you. They explained that Alfa Romeo wants them to run the test and document it otherwise they will not re-emburse them for the battery. Fair enough. As an electrical engineer though I would never put back in my car a battery that went to 4.6V
